The neutron number, symbol N, is the number of neutrons in a nuclide. Atomic number (proton number) plus neutron number equals mass number: Z + N = A. The difference between the neutron number and the atomic number is known as the neutron excess: D = N - Z = A - 2Z.The nucleus with equal numbers of protons and neutrons will be the one with the lowest energy.
